Suggest Treatment For Swollen And Painful Lips And Cheeks
Hi my husband got swelling on his lips and cheeks... Some time on the left side some time on right side cheek some time on top lip or bottom lip.... It started from January... Never this happend before... He got swelling 4-5 times now... He s eating piriton everyday but when this happened he takes 3 times a day... He s going for allergy test... Is it ok to eat piriton everyday and when he s going to allergy test how many day before he has to stop? What do you think for his swelling....
I can understand your concern. It seems that what your husband is experiencing is an allergic reaction only so it is good that you have already decided to go for allergy test.
The allergy test will test blood and the report will show what substances are acting as allergen for your husband and he will have to stop exposure to them. I would like to caution you that the future allergic reactions might be higher in severity than the episodes he is experiencing now.
In addition, if he is having an allergic reaction now, you can continue piriton till the reaction subsides. Then you can discontinue the medicine for 48-72 hours and go for allergy test.
